🔴 Detainees’ organizations issue a report on the most significant information and data related to detainees in Israeli prisons during 2024

🔴 The bloodiest year in the history of the Captive Movement

Ramallah- detainees organizations (Commission of Detainees’ Affairs, Palestinian Prisoner’s Society, Addameer Association for Human Rights) issued a report summarizing key issues and data regarding the situation of Palestinian detainees in Israeli prisons during 2024.
This year has been marked as the bloodiest in the history of the Palestinian struggle against the Israeli occupation.

The report includes an extensive analysis of policies, statistics, and the horrific crimes committed by the Israeli occupation during arrest campaigns, particularly in the West Bank, which escalated following the onset of what has been described as a war of extermination.

This is in the light of the ongoing comprehensive aggression against the Palestinian people and the continuous genocide in Gaza for more than 450 days.

The report highlights significant transformations afflicting the conditions of detainees following the war, as part of broader systemic changes imposed by the Israeli prison authorities over recent years. It also documents the widespread crimes witnessed, including severe torture of detainees, enforced disappearances of detainees from Gaza, administrative detentions, and systematic killings of detainees.
Since the start of the war, (54) detainees and prisoners have been killed, whose identities are confirmed. Among them, (35) martyrs were from Gaza. In total, (43) detainees were killed in 2024.

The report is based on daily field monitoring of arrests, reports from legal teams within the organizations, and numerous testimonies documented throughout the year.

Attached is Statistical data on detention campaigns and numbers of Palestinian detainees since the onset of the genocide until the end of 2024.

Total arrest cases during 2024 stands at (8800) in the West Bank and Jerusalem, (14,300) since the beginning of war

This data excludes arrest cases carried out in the Gaza Strip, estimated at thousands .

Women: the total number of women arrests stands at (266) during 2024, and more than (450) since the beginning of war, including women arrested from the lands occupied in 1948, in addition to tens of Gazan women who have been arrested in the West Bank, estimated at tens.

. Children: the number of children arrests stands at (700) during 2024, and (1055) since the beginning of war
. Journalists: (145) journalists have been arrested since the beginning of war.

. Physicians: (320) physicians have been arrested from the West Bank and Gaza since the beginning of war.

More than (10000) orders of administrative detention have been issued since October 7, ranging between new orders and renewals, including orders against children and women.

Detention campaigns carried out since October 7 are accompanied by escalated crimes and violations such as humiliation, brutal beat, threats against detainees and their families, besides to vandalism and destruction in detainees’ houses, confiscating vehicles, gold and money, in addition to the destruction of infrastructure especially in the refugee camps of Tulkarem and demolitions of detainees houses, using family members as hostages, in addition to using detainees as human shields.

Statistics include detainees who were arrested from their houses, on checkpoints, who surrendered themselves and those who were arrested as hostages.

Besides to detention campaigns, the Israeli forces implemented field executions, afflicted detainees and their family members.

It has been noted that the information about arrest cases in the West Bank include detainees who still under arrest, and released ones.

The highest record of arrest cases was in Hebron and Jerusalem.

Data exclude detention cases of Gaza, due to the occupation’s refusal to give any information and the continuation of practicing the crime of enforced disappearance against them. It is worth mentioning that the occupation forces arrested hundreds of Gazan workers from the West Bank, in addition to Gazans who have been in the West Bank for treatment. Moreover, they arrested more than ( 1000) citizens from northern Gaza.

Detainees’ organizations and the Captive Movement in Israeli prisons mourn the the national fighter and former detainee , Major General Fouad Al-Shobaki

Ramallah
Detainees’ organizations, the Captive Movement in Israeli prisons and former detainees in homeland and diaspora mourn the national fighter and former detainees, Major General Fouad Al Shobaki, who passed away this evening at the age of 84.

Detainees’ organizations stated that we are mourning a national fighter and a former detainee who served 17 years in Israeli prisons, and was the oldest one among other detainees and was called the “sheikh of detainees”.

About of the Late Major General Fouad Al-Shobaki's Life

. Fouad Hijazi Mohammad Shobaki: was born on March 12, 1940 in Gaza Strip. He had the BA in Accounting from Cairo University.

. He was a Palestinian politician and military figure, and a member of Fatah movement. He was the head of the central militant financial administration in the Palestinian security apparatus. He joined Fatah movement and relocated to Jordan, Lebanon, Syria and Tunisia.

On January 3, 2002, the Israeli occupation army implemented a military operation called “Noah’s Ark” to stop and control the ship Karin A in the Red Sea, claiming that the ship carried military supplies for Palestinians. They charged him with this incident being the mastermind of funding and smuggling of the arms ship.

. The Israeli occupation forces abducted him in 14/3/2006 from Jericho prison, with the Secretary-General of the Popular Front, Ahmed Sa’adat, and their companions, Ahed Abu Ghoulmi, Hamdi Qar’an, Basel Al-Asmar, Majdi Al-Rimawi, and Yasser Abu Turki.

. The military court of the occupation sentenced him to (20) years, and reduced later to (17) years.

. His wife passed away in 2011, and he was deprived of bidding farewell.

. He was released on march 2023, and he was suffering from chronic diseases during his detention, and he was relying on his companions for assistance.

Minor Detainees held in Megiddo prison are victims to jailers’ hatred

December 8, 2024

The Commission of Detainees’ Affairs stated that minor detainees held in Megiddo prison are victims to the jailers’ hatred and racism, who deal with those children in a brutal manner.

The Commission pointed out that the administration of Megiddo prison exploits their young age and feeble physical structure to intimidate them by storming their rooms, and beating them severely. The mistreatment is politicized and aims at affecting their psychological and mental health.

The commission’s lawyer recounted a minor detainee who had been transferred from Megiddo prison to Damoun prison, stating that the health and living conditions of children detainees are tragic, as there are special forces who exist constantly in front of their section, and commit crimes and assaults against those children.
It is worth mentioning that the total number of minor detainees in Israeli prisons stands at 280.

Constant Medical ignorance against our detainees in Israeli prisons

December 15, 2024

The Commission of Detainees’ Affairs disclosed several cases for sick detainees held in Negev and Jelboa prisons.
A case in point is the detainee Rashad Karajah, 61, from Saffa/ Ramallah, who is currently held in Negev prison and suffers from disc in the back. His pain increases with the cold weather in the Negev desert. He also has problems in the testicles, and he lost 45 kgs.

Another case in point is detainee Saeb Khamaysa from Jenin. He is currently held in Negev prison and suffers from scabies since last August.
On October 27, he collapsed during yard time due to severe pain, in addition to the spread of boils all over his body. It is worth noting that he has lost about 15 kgs.

The last case in point is detainee Rafiq Kabaj, from Tulkarem/Resident in Ramallah - Albirah. He is held in "Jelboa" prison, and suffers from heart disease, causing him heart attacks. He was receiving treatment in the hospital before his arrest and was taking specific medication to regulate his heart rate. Since his arrest, he has not received these medications, and the prison administration has intentionally neglected him and failed to provide the necessary treatment.

The commission holds the administration of prisons fully accountable for the constant medical ignorance practiced against Palestinian detainees, and called on international human rights organizations and the ICRC to fulfill their obligations toward Palestinian detainees.

🔴 Statistical data on detention campaigns and numbers of Palestinian detainees since the onset of the genocide

🔴 Total arrest cases stands at 11,900 in the West Bank and Jerusalem


Women: the total number of women arrests stands at (435) including women arrested from the lands occupied in 1948, in addition to tens of Gazan women who have been arrested in the West Bank, estimated at tens.
. Children: the number of children arrests stands at (790)
. Journalists: (136) journalists have been arrested, (58) of them are still under arrest, including (5) female journalists and (32) journalists at least from Gaza.

More than (10.000) orders of administrative detention have been issued since October 7, ranging between new orders and renewals, including orders against children and women.

Detention campaigns carried out since October 7 are accompanied by escalated crimes and violations such as humiliation, brutal beat, threats against detainees and their families, besides to vandalism and destruction in detainees’ houses, confiscating vehicles, gold and money, in addition to the destruction of infrastructure especially in the refugee camps of Tulkarem and demolitions of detainees houses, using family members as hostages, in addition to using detainees as human shields.

Statistics include detainees who were arrested from their houses, on checkpoints, who surrendered themselves and those who were arrested as hostages.

Besides to detention campaigns, the Israeli forces implemented field executions, afflicted detainees and their family members.

The highest record of arrest cases was in Hebron and Jerusalem

🔴 (47) detainees martyred in Israeli prisons and military camps since the 7th of October, in addition to (29) martyrs from Gaza who died in Israeli prisons and detention centers, whom the occupation has not announced their names or martyrdom conditions. Moreover, they acknowledged the execution of many detainees.

The remains of (45) detainees who martyred after October 7 are still withheld, among (56) martyrs.

Data exclude detention cases of Gaza, due to the occupation’s refusal to give any information and the continuation of practicing the crime of enforced disappearance against them. It is worth mentioning that the occupation forces arrested hundreds of Gazan workers from the West Bank, in addition to Gazans who have been in the West Bank for treatment. Moreover, they arrested more than (1000) citizens from northern Gaza.

🔴 Total number of detainees held in Israeli prisons until December 2024

The total number of detainees held in Israeli prisons stands at(10,300), including (3428) administrative detainees and (100) children and (27) women sentenced to administrative detention, in addition to (1772) detainees who have been classified as illegal fighters.

.(88) female detainees are held in Damoun prison, including (4) detainees from Gaza, in addition to (27) administrative detainees.
These figures exclude women detainees from Gaza, as there might be detainees held in military camps and facilities of the occupation.

. (280) children are currently held in isolation prisons

Before October 7: the total number of detainees held in Israeli prisons was (5250), including (40) women, (170) children and (1320) administrative detainees.

Note: data on detention campaigns is variable on a daily basis due to the continuous arrests

Escalated retaliatory and aggressive policies against Palestinian women held in Damoun prison

December 8, 2024

The Commission of Detainees’ Affairs warned of the escalated retaliatory and aggressive policies practiced against Palestinian women held in Damoun prison, besides the inhumane and unethical treatment pursued by jailers, who try to harm them on a physical and psychological level.

The Commission emphasized that the visitations managed by the commission’s legal team to Damoun prison documented the intensity of the crimes committed against women, as they focused on psychological abuse represented in threats of rape, strip searches, curses, beating and starvation.
Moreover, they are deprived of clothes, covers, sanitizers ,feminine hygiene products, ignoring their health conditions and procrastinating in providing medicine.
The commission pointed out that the collective punishment is implemented persistently, as detainees are periodically banned from having a shower and prevented from getting out to the prison’s yard.
Any inquiry by detainees may lead to an incursion, abuse and torture.

The commission called on feminine rights organizations, associations and local and international to collaborate to expose the constant violations practiced against Palestinians women detainees to form a public opinion that help in ending their suffering.

The Commission of Detainees’ Affairs disclose the health conditions of the injured detainee Hassounah, held in the clinic of Alramla prison

November 25, 2024

The lawyer of the commission managed to visit detainee Saleh Hassounah, 28, from Jalazom refugee camp, held in the clinic of Alramla prison.
The Company stated that the Israeli forces stormed the house of detainee Hassounah and shot him in the legs many times. He was severely beaten which led to fragments in his legs. He was transferred to Shaare Zedek, where he remained 52 days, and had 7 surgeries to implant Platinum in his leg, in addition to another surgery in 11/10/2024 to transfer bones to the leg. The detainee is still using a wheelchair, where he attended the visit shackled from the legs, in spite of his injury.

It is worth mentioning that Hassounah is sentenced to 6 months of administrative detention since 29/2/2024, and renewed for additional 6 months.

Detainees held in the clinic of Alramla prison are living difficult conditions, where they are served with poor food in quantity and quality, which led to the deterioration of their health conditions. Some of them need to be transferred to hospitals, but the administration of prison keeps procrastinating.
There are a high number of detainees from Gaza in the clinic of Alramla prison, suffering from difficult mental and psychological conditions, which were deteriorated after the martyrdom of many detainees inside the section since October 7, 2023.
